WPRB has begun building its off-campus studio and the first important piece of equipment arrived today. Behold! Our new Wheatstone mini-console. For a board of its size, it has a nice long fader throw, but I really wish the sliders had more resistance. This is a major industry peeve of mine... There's a unique satisfaction to using older consoles, whose faders were purposefully designed with some physical resistance behind them. (Or perhaps the ones I developed my radio chops with were just real dirty, which is entirely possible.) Nevertheless, most modern boards make it seem like I could sneeze and accidentally put my mic, two turntables, and the request line on the air all at once in doing so.
